Gloria Victis, c. 1880. Antonin Mercié (French, 1845–1916). Bronze with gilding; overall: 73.7 cm (29 in.); without base: 71.2 cm (28 1/16 in.). The Cleveland Museum of Art, Gift of Robert Hays Gries 1964.375

inscription: Signed near foot at right: "A. MERCIE."; inscribed rear: "F. BARBEDIENNE. FONDEUR."; inscribed front of base: "GLORIA VICTIS."
